MAIN WIRE HARNESS 7.23
GENERAL
The main wire harness runs from the front of the motorcycle
to the tail section where it connects to the tail section mini-
harness.
Always replace plastic tree fasteners when replacing main
wire harness. Remove tree fasteners carefully, do not leave
any fasteners in frame.
REMOVAL
NOTES
● To ensure correct installation, make note of wire routing
and cable strap locations before removing main wire har-
ness.
● Main wire harness is removed from front of vehicle in
between fork tube and frame.
1. Remove seat. See 2.38 SEAT.
1WARNING1WARNING
Disconnect negative (-) battery cable first. If positive (+)
cable should contact ground with negative (-) cable con-
nected, the resulting sparks can cause a battery explo-
sion, which could result in death or serious injury.
(00049a)
2. Unthread fastener and remove battery negative cable
(black) from battery negative (-) terminal.
3. Pull back terminal cover boot.
4. Unthread fastener and remove battery positive cable
(red) from battery positive (+) terminal.
5. Disconnect positive battery cable and solenoid connec-
tor [128] from starter.
6. Remove tail frame upper body work. 2.36 SUBFRAME
TAIL ASSEMBLY AND BODY WORK.
7. See Figure 7-77. Disconnect tail harness connector [7]
(3).
8. See Figure 7-78. Remove wire harness ground (2).
9. Remove main fuse case (3).
10. Disconnect interactive exhaust connector [165B] from
main harness (XB12 models only).
11. Disconnect foot brake light switch connector [121] (5).
12. Remove the rear shock absorber assembly and reser-
voir. See 2.22 REAR SHOCK ABSORBER.
13. Remove fan. See 4.38 COOLING FAN.
